Will she ever escape her past?
Poppy's life has never been easy. Becoming a mum at sixteen, falling out with her family and being abandoned by her boyfriend has left her feeling lost and alone, but her son is a ray of light in her life and the pair form a strong bond: It's the two of them against the world.
Many years later, with her son grown up and away at university, Poppy arrives desperate, exhausted and half-starved to a pretty doorstep, hoping to find sanctuary in the home of her old school friend Harriet - and it is clear things have gone horribly wrong.
Finding Harriet living with her sister Jessica and nephew Reef, Poppy soon settles into a comfortable life in their rural village, helping Harriet in her delightful fabric shop, and believing the sisters have offered her a way to start again with a clean slate.
But as the hardships she has fled catch up with her, and cracks in the sister's strange relationship begin to show, Poppy is suspicious of Harriet's true motivations for helping her and fears her only option will be to flee once again.
With bonds between the three women tested to breaking point, and dark secrets revealed, will Poppy find safety and happiness, or has she simply fled one nightmare to end up in another?
No Safe Haven is a twisty tale of friendship, family and loyalty in a world where everyone has something to hide.
